Crispy Buffalo Roasted Cauliflower Bites with Greek Yogurt Dip

INGREDIENTS
1 medium head Cauliflower (600g)
2 tbsp Almond Flour (14g)
1 tbsp Olive Oil (14g)
2 tbsp Buffalo Hot Sauce (30g)
1/2 tsp Garlic Powder (1.5g)
1 pinch Salt (0.5g)
1 pinch Pepper (0.5g)
1 cup Nonfat Greek Yogurt (245g)
PREPARATION
Preheat your oven to 425°F (220°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
Wash and cut the cauliflower into bite-sized florets. In a large bowl, toss the florets with olive oil, almond flour, garlic powder, salt, and pepper until evenly coated.
Spread the cauliflower in a single layer on the prepared baking sheet. Roast in the preheated oven for about 25-30 minutes, flipping halfway through, until the edges are crisp and the florets are tender.
Warm the buffalo hot sauce in a small saucepan over low heat or in the microwave. Once roasted, transfer the cauliflower to a clean bowl, drizzle the buffalo sauce over the roasted florets, and gently toss to coat thoroughly.
Serve the spicy cauliflower bites with a generous side of nonfat Greek yogurt for dipping. Enjoy these bites hot for the best flavor and texture.
